Irish brown soda bread with buttermilk
WebJan 31, 2024 · It's traditionally made with just four ingredients: wholemeal flour (more about that later), baking soda, salt, and buttermilk. But those minimal ingredients make a crusty bread with a savory, nutty flavor that pairs well with a wide variety of foods. WebJan 1, 2016 · 1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
